A simple interest loan is a type of loan where the interest is calculated only on the initial principal amount, without adding previously accrued interest to the principal. This differs from compound interest loans, where interest is calculated on the initial principal plus any previously accumulated interest.

Understanding Simple Interest Loans
Simple interest loans are popular for their predictability. The interest amount doesn't change over time, as it would with a compound interest loan. This predictability makes budgeting and financial planning easier.

The interest rate and the loan term remain constant throughout the life of the loan. Therefore, the total amount you'll pay in interest can be calculated upfront. This transparency can help borrowers make informed decisions about the loans they choose.
The Simple Interest Formula

The formula for simple interest is: I = P * R * T, where I is the interest, P is the principal amount (initial loan amount), R is the annual interest rate (expressed as a decimal), and T is the time the money is borrowed for, in years.
Using this formula, you can calculate your loan's interest as well as the total repayment amount, which is the sum of the principal and the interest.
Example of Simple Interest Calculation

Let's say you're considering a simple interest loan of $5,000 with an annual interest rate of 5% over a 3-year term. Plugging these numbers into our formula, the interest amount would be:
I = 5000 * 0.05 * 3 = $750
Therefore, the total amount you'd repay after three years would be:

Total Repayment = Principal + Interest = $5,000 + $750 = $5,750
